4757884 - FUEL PUMP ASSEMBLY
FUEL PUMP ASSEMBLY
FUEL PUMP ASSEMBLY
Part Number
4757884
Manufacturer
IVECO
Lead Time
4WKS
UoM
EA
Contact for detailed specifications and availability.
